### Ceremony Item 3 — PlanGuard Baseline Key

Quick one for the reviewer: after the Quillbrook query-planner regression, we sign known-good plan baselines so rollbacks are trustworthy. Confirm the signing laptop stayed offline and the diff of baseline hashes matches the ledger. Then unlock the signing enclave with the passphrase below.

unlock words, fafop-hawep: briwyn-oliix-sorox

Hey Priya — handing off the Gatewarden validator plugin system before the cut. All core plugins pass the conformance suite; the schema-drift one is flagged experimental, so don't ship it. Release notes are drafted in the usual folder. To sign the plugin bundle you'll need to unlock the signing store, and the recovery passphrase is right below.

strongbox words: zorath-holmir

## Runbook: Connection Pool Changes

Plugin authors integrating with the Ostermill data layer: release 7.1 caps per-plugin pool size at twelve connections and enforces a two-second acquisition timeout. Audit your plugins for long-held connections and release them promptly, or requests will queue and time out. After updating, run the pool stress check in the sandbox. Signed plugin packages only — sign your archive with the key below.

release key, fafof-hawip: bky6_52YEwQ